Elkhart (IN) Daily Review, September 13, 1898, p. 1.
FOUND HANGING IN A CORN CRIB
Scottsburg, Indiana, September 13-Thomas Hardy, a member of a prominent
family in Lexington Township, this county, was found dead hanging in a corn
crib when relatives returned from church. He had for years prospected for
and found gold in small quantities in Saluda Creek. He was considered weak
minded. No cause is known for the rash act.
